The coronavirus pandemic in Israel: A comparison between holocaust survivors and other older adults
INTRODUCTION: The COVID-19 pandemic places older adults at increased risk for hospitalization and mortality. It also involves social isolation and negative effects of limited mental, social and physical activity. Holocaust survivors could be especially vulnerable to such effects due to their early l...
